java开发的数据库有什么
-
Java开发的数据库有以下几种:
-
MySQL:MySQL是一种开源的关系型数据库管理系统,具有高性能、可靠性和灵活性。它支持多种操作系统和编程语言,包括Java。Java开发者可以使用MySQL来存储和管理数据。
-
Oracle:Oracle是一种商业级关系型数据库管理系统,被广泛用于企业级应用。它提供了高度可扩展的架构和丰富的功能,同时也支持Java开发。Java开发者可以使用Oracle数据库来构建大规模的企业应用。
-
SQL Server:SQL Server是由微软开发的关系型数据库管理系统。它提供了强大的功能和性能优化,同时也支持Java开发。Java开发者可以使用SQL Server来构建各种类型的应用程序。
-
PostgreSQL:PostgreSQL是一种开源的关系型数据库管理系统,具有高度可靠性和可扩展性。它支持多种操作系统和编程语言,包括Java。Java开发者可以使用PostgreSQL来构建可靠和高性能的应用程序。
-
MongoDB:MongoDB是一种开源的文档数据库管理系统,具有高度可扩展性和灵活性。它使用JSON格式来存储和查询数据,适合处理大量非结构化数据。Java开发者可以使用MongoDB来构建大规模的分布式应用程序。
总之,Java开发者可以根据具体的需求和项目要求选择适合的数据库。以上列举的数据库都是常用的Java开发数据库,具有不同的特点和适用场景,开发者可以根据项目需求选择合适的数据库来进行开发。
1年前 -
-
Java开发中常用的数据库有以下几种:
-
MySQL:MySQL是一种关系型数据库管理系统,被广泛应用于Java开发领域。它具有开源、性能优异、易于部署和使用的特点,支持事务处理和ACID特性。
-
Oracle:Oracle是一种商业化的关系型数据库管理系统。它具有强大的功能和高性能,适用于大型企业级应用。Oracle也提供了Java数据库连接(JDBC)驱动程序,使得Java开发人员可以方便地与Oracle数据库进行交互。
-
SQL Server:SQL Server是由微软开发的关系型数据库管理系统。它具有良好的可扩展性和安全性,适用于Windows平台上的Java应用程序开发。
-
PostgreSQL:PostgreSQL是一个开源的关系型数据库管理系统,提供了丰富的功能和高度可扩展性。它支持许多高级特性,如复杂查询、事务处理和并发控制。
-
MongoDB:MongoDB是一种NoSQL数据库,采用文档存储模式。它具有高度的可扩展性和灵活性,适用于处理大量非结构化数据的场景。Java开发人员可以使用MongoDB的Java驱动程序与数据库进行交互。
除了以上几种常用的数据库之外,还有一些其他的数据库适用于特定的场景,如Redis、Elasticsearch等。根据具体的需求和项目要求,开发人员可以选择合适的数据库来支持Java应用程序的开发。
1年前 -
-
Java开发的数据库有很多种,常用的有以下几种:
-
MySQL:MySQL是最流行的开源关系型数据库管理系统之一。它具有高性能、可靠性和可伸缩性,并且支持多种操作系统。
-
Oracle:Oracle是一种功能强大的关系型数据库管理系统。它提供了高级的事务管理、数据安全和高可用性功能,并且适用于大型企业级应用程序。
-
Microsoft SQL Server:Microsoft SQL Server是由微软公司开发的关系型数据库管理系统。它提供了强大的数据管理和分析功能,并且与其他微软产品的集成性很好。
-
PostgreSQL:PostgreSQL是一个功能强大的开源关系型数据库管理系统。它具有高度可扩展性和可定制性,并且支持复杂的数据类型和高级的查询功能。
-
SQLite:SQLite是一种嵌入式关系型数据库管理系统。它是一个轻量级的数据库引擎,适用于小型应用程序和移动设备。
-
MongoDB:MongoDB是一种NoSQL数据库,它使用文档存储格式来存储数据。它具有高度可扩展性和灵活性,并且适用于处理非结构化数据。
以上是常用的几种Java开发的数据库,开发人员可以根据项目需求选择适合的数据库来存储和管理数据。在选择数据库时,需要考虑数据量、性能、安全性、可扩展性等因素。同时,还需要掌握数据库的相关操作和SQL语言的基本知识,以便能够有效地使用和管理数据库。
1年前 -